AFTER YANG is a US sci-fi drama in which a man makes a significant discovery when his family's AI robot suddenly malfunctions.
threat and horror
Moments of threat are brief, including a man acting aggressively towards another while demanding an answer to his question. In another sequence, a man finds out that his AI robot has been carrying spyware which enabled it to record him and his family.
language
There is mild bad language ('shit' and 'bullshit').
flashing/flickering lights
This work contains flashing images which may affect viewers who are susceptible to photosensitive epilepsy.
additional issues
There are infrequent verbal references to relationships between an AI robot and humans but these are discreet. A young girl recalls that her classmates were teasing her about her adopted parents, but the AI robot she is close to helps her to see her family as important as everyone else's, despite how it was built. There are scenes in which a robot has its chest cavity exposed during an examination but this does not include blood or human anatomical detail. There are also scenes of very mild emotional upset and references to bereavement.
